I would rather spend 15 minutes strategizing how to entice "Fluffy" back in their crate than try to force them. For potty visits, I prefer to clip a long drag line to the dogs harness or collar- just in case they don't respond to a recall from me, or if there is any chance at all they might make a break for it! That way, we can still play and have fun, but with a safe guard in place. For walks, I will always want to specify if you are wanting a structured walk or a sniffari, or a combination. Structured walking is only available to dogs that already know how to walk on a loose leash. If you are interested in loose leash walking, that is something we can work on! For feeding or medications, I will need exact instructions! How much food, what you use to measure it (example: 1 full scoop with the blue cup on the counter, 8oz raw thawed in fridge, fill up the black kong, etc), and amount of supplements or extras. For oral meds, please specify if it needs to be "hidden" and what to hide it in (wet food, pb, etc.)
